We are installing a 1000kw generator and are considering adding an ATS from automatic switchover. Without the ATS, a manual breaker would need to be switched to the generator to supply backup power.

NEC 701.5 a reads "Transfer equipment, including ATS's, shall be automatic..."

Is my interpretation correct that the generator will require an ATS or other method of automatic transfer instead of a manual switchover?

At a 1,000 KW I highly doubt it is an article 700 or 701 installation.

It is much more likely it is an article 702 optional standby installation which means a manual transfer method is allowed.
